The Safety Map application suite provides a comprehensive, singular web based platform to mitigate risk and liability – while improving safety and workflow efficiency for employees within healthcare, research and construction environments.

Project Overview

Specifically the Safety Map platform provides a centralized cloud-based data repository with mobile interface for managing risks related to emergency response, federal and state compliance and  general safety & health within internal and external work environments. The platform increases the efficiency of collecting, managing and analyzing data related to environmental health and safety issues – and aims to reduce injuries among employees and patients, damage to equipment and facilities, regulatory failures and business disruptions.

  • Includes algorithms for predictive analytics and risk mitigation
  • Enables advanced user management and security features
  • Cloud computing; iPhone, iPad, and Web browser, allowing for mobile use, data entry, reporting, analytics, and peer-to-peer benchmarking

Healthcare Context

In 2011, the Occupational Safety & Health Administration (OSHA) reported that employees in U.S. hospitals experience nearly double the rate of work-related injuries compared to the average for all industries. In 2012 OSHA reported that hospitals also have the highest lost-time injury rates of all industries, exceeding construction and manufacturing.  Despite this high rate and severity of employee injuries and illnesses, there is no comprehensive platform for environmental health & safety risk management in the healthcare and biomedical research industries. The EH&S platform aims to fill that gap.
